The emergence of high-speed digital processors and modern converters has enabled the use of closed-loop control in contrast to open-loop control. The motion controller receives feedback data from the Voltage Monitoring or Current Monitoring and Rotor/Load Shaft Position blocks in order to assess the performance of the motor. Using pre-programmed software, the motion controller can then adjust the drive (via the Gate driver and Power Stage) to the motor if required to achieve optimal performance of the motor. This is a double closed loop system - motor performance data comes from the voltage monitoring or current monitoring loop and the second motor performance data comes from Rotor/Load, Shaft Position loop. Using this feedback data the motor can then be driven at its optimum performance via the Motion Controller.
